About This
- HIGH QUALITY: It is easy to use permanent bonding method provides high strength and long-term durability. It consists of a durable acrylic strong adhesive with viscoelastic properties. This provides an extraordinarily strong double sided foam tape and offers design flexibility with its viscoelasticity and powerful ability to bond a variety of surfaces.
- BOND SMOOTH SURFACE: Bonds most painted metal and plastic without surface residue or abrading. Specially formulated synthetic adhesive bonds most paints and powder coats, as well as window materials such as glass, acrylic, and polycarbonate, stone and wood.
- FEATURE: Clean, smooth appearance on walls and doors with no spot weld defects and refinishing. Pressure sensitive adhesive for quick application with immediate handling strength to speed assembly. Strength to replace mechanical fasteners and spot welds in many applications. Neat application without the mess and curing delay as liquid adhesives. The 5952 tape can replace mechanical fasteners (rivets, welds, screws) or liquid adhesives.
- INSTALLATION TIPS: At room temperature, approximately 50% of the ultimate strength will be achieved after 20 minutes, 90% after 24 hours and 100% after 72 hours. Use a knife to cut a corners of the adhesive side for easier film liner peel off.
- APPLICATIONS :Recommended applications like decorative material and trim, nameplates and logos, electronic displays, panel to frame, stiffener to panel. Our bonding tapes provide excellent shear strength, conformability, surface adhesion and temperature resistance. They are commonly used in applications across a variety of markets including transportation, appliance, electronics, construction, sign and display and general industrial.
